Friends of the OBP

The Wildcare Friends of the Orange-bellied Parrot (OBP) group works across the OBP’s range with a focus on Tasmania.

The objectives of the group are to:

  • Assist with the monitoring program at Melaleuca (SW Tasmania).
  • Conduct migration and winter surveys in various locations from Strahan to Arthur River – read about our August 2022 Winter Migration Survey.
  • Assist with OBP habitat management projects.
  • Raise awareness of the plight of the OBP.
  • Raise funds (including through our online shop) to support the activities of volunteers and other recovery actions.

Members of our group conduct a number of annual migration surveys on the west and north-west coasts. In 2024, surveys are being planned for the weekends of:

  • 24-25 February – Strahan, Trial Harbour and Granville Harbour
  • 16-17 March – Arthur River and Woolnorth
  • 24 April to 1 May – King Island* (expressions of interest will be called for this survey)
  • 18-19 May – Arthur River and Woolnorth
  • 27-28 July – Strahan, Trial Harbour and Granville Harbour
  • 14-15 September – Arthur River and Woolnorth
